Output 56a3ca28f687e30a25bed240c8571cc3096e52e532b2acc325a3e5494fcee1ae:95

value
320277
script pubkey
OP_0 OP_PUSHBYTES_20 91bc69ad1fc47a089b6e96b9eb0931b8e8f3be5c
address
bc1qjx7xntglc3aq3xmwj6u7kzf3hr5080jua35zm9
transaction
56a3ca28f687e30a25bed240c8571cc3096e52e532b2acc325a3e5494fcee1ae